Japanese Voyeurs

Hello world.

We're Japanese Voyeurs . We enjoy spitting and cursing and days in the park. Don’t forget to do your homework kids. And eat your greens. And don’t stay up late. Or you’ll end up like us...

Loud music can solve all of your problems. Who needs therapy when you’ve got escapism? In a culture saturated with phony piety we want to get down to the rotting core of things. So what you feel like shit and everyone hates you? We say blame it on your parents and come party with us.

We write songs about infantile fantasies, crushing disappointments and sexual repression – actually, all kinds of repression. We’re repressed. We’re trying to get unrepressed. Or undressed. Either is fine, really. Our writing method is pretty simple; if it feels right, we put it in the song. Maybe that’s why some people say it sounds like vomit…

We don’t really know much at all about music in a technical sense; key changes and time signatures are a bit baffling. It would be nice to sound like At the Drive-In but that’s like a glimmer on the horizon. Of Mars. For now its power chords and psychotic guitar riffs, lots of screaming mixed with lots of melodies. You see we’re really pissed off but also pretty scared. Like an angry baby.

The band was recently in Vancouver, recording their debut album with Garth Richardson which will be released on Fiction Records later this year.
